Laurie Ellinghausen here analyzes how the concept of labor as a calling, which was assisted by early modern experiments in democracy, print, and Protestant religion, had a lasting effect on the history of authorship as a profession. Among the authors discussed are Ben Jonson; the maidservant and poet Isabella Whitney; the journalist and satirist Thomas Nashe; the boatman John Taylor "The Water Poet"; and the Puritan radical George Wither.

"In spite of extensive fiscal reforms undertaken during the nineties, Indias public finances face numerous problems. While the taxation system remains distortionary and fragmented, government expenditures remain inefficient in providing public and merit goods to the desired extent. Vertical imbalance and horizontal disparities characterise the federal fiscal system. The fiscal reform years have witnessed a sharp rise in the fiscal imbalance and deterioration in state finances. his book undertakes a comprehensive review of the contemporary issues in Indias public finances within a long-term perspective tracing its evolution since 1950-51. It critically analyses the causes of fiscal imbalance, the tensions that prevail in centre-state financial relations, the progress of decentralization, and issues related with the structure of taxation as well as government expenditures. It examines the impact of public finances on the macro economy and looks at fiscal policy options for growth, stability and poverty alleviation. "

Joining previous editions on other Indian states, this report focuses on Sikkim, a state that is a popular tourist destination for its culture, scenic beauty, and biodiversity. Analyzing the entire range of the state’s development issues of interest to businesses, nongovernmental organizations, research organizations, and policy makers, this volume discusses the constraints and challenges faced by Sikkim and provides a blueprint for its socioeconomic progress.
